About

Alexander John Bond is a scholar working on Sociology and Political Science, Economics and Econometrics and Gender Studies. According to data from OpenAlex, Alexander John Bond has authored 23 papers receiving a total of 469 ind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 17 papers in Sociology and Political Science, 15 papers in Economics and Econometrics and 15 papers in Gender Studies. Recurrent topics in Alexander John Bond’s work include Sports, Gender, and Society (15 papers), Sport and Mega-Event Impacts (14 papers) and Sports Analytics and Performance (14 papers). Alexander John Bond is often cited by papers focused on Sports, Gender, and Society (15 papers), Sport and Mega-Event Impacts (14 papers) and Sports Analytics and Performance (14 papers). Alexander John Bond collaborates with scholars based in United Kingdom, Portugal and Canada. Alexander John Bond's co-authors include Paul Widdop, Daniel Parnell, Rob Wilson, Jan André Lee Ludvigsen, Ryan Groom, Simon Chadwick, Daniel Plumley, Daniel Kilvington, Clive Beggs and Jonathan Long and has published in prestigious journals such as PLoS ONE, American Behavioral Scientist and Leisure Sciences.
